react-native-wheel-picker 使用指南
react-native-wheel-pick项目地址:https://gitcode.com/gh_mirrors/re/react-native-wheel-pick
欢迎来到 react-native-wheel-picker
的安装与使用教程。此库为一个高效的轮播选择器组件,适用于React Native,支持iOS和Android平台,并提供了诸如日期选择、日期范围以及省市区三级选择等多种模式。下面是关于其主要结构、启动文件以及配置文件的详细说明。
1. 项目目录结构及介绍
由于提供的链接指向了一个不同的GitHub仓库(实际上应是yz1311/react-native-wheel-picker
而非错误的引用),以下基于常规React Native组件库的目录结构来解读,具体细节可能有所差异:
android
和ios
:这两个目录分别包含了Android和iOS平台上的原生代码,用于桥接到JavaScript层。src
:这是存放JavaScript源代码的地方,一般包含核心组件如WheelPicker
,CommonPicker
,DatePicker
, 等。example
或 示例代码:通常在一些库中,会有这样的目录提供如何使用的示例应用。package.json
: 此文件定义了项目的依赖、脚本命令以及其他元数据,是Node.js项目的核心配置文件。README.md
: 包含项目简介、安装步骤、基本用法等重要信息。- 可能存在的配置文件如
tsconfig.json
、.flowconfig
、.gitignore
等,它们分别用于TypeScript编译设置、Flow类型检查配置和忽略Git版本控制的文件列表。
2. 项目的启动文件介绍
在大多数React Native项目中,启动文件通常是index.js
或App.js
。虽然上述仓库未明确指出,但一般流程包括:
index.js
: 应用程序的入口点,这里引入根组件并启动React Native应用。对于示例或测试应用,它也可能直接展示如何使用react-native-wheel-picker
组件。
import { AppRegistry } from 'react-native';
import App from './App';
import { name as appName } from './app.json';
AppRegistry.registerComponent(appName, () => App);
对于这个特定的库,启动文件可能还演示了如何初始化和使用 picker 组件。
3. 项目的配置文件介绍
package.json
:重要的配置文件,列出项目依赖、脚本命令等。安装本库和它的依赖时,你需要查看这里的dependencies
部分,通过npm或yarn执行相应的安装命令,比如使用npm install react-native-wheel-picker
。
{
"name": "your_project_name",
"version": "0.0.1",
"dependencies": {
"react-native-wheel-picker": "^x.x.x"
// 其他依赖项...
},
"scripts": {
"start": "react-native start",
"android": "react-native run-android",
"ios": "react-native run-ios"
}
}
- React Native特定配置:对于这个组件,如果涉及到原生模块的集成,你可能会需要对iOS的
Podfile
进行编辑或在Android的settings.gradle
和app/build.gradle
中添加对应的原生库引用。
请注意,实际的目录结构和文件内容应以仓库中的实际文件为准,此处提供的是基于常见React Native项目的一般性描述。对于具体的配置和文件细节,务必参照项目最新的README.md
文件或相关文档。
react-native-wheel-pick项目地址:https://gitcode.com/gh_mirrors/re/react-native-wheel-pick
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考